Best Bridesmaid Robe Colours for Every Wedding Theme (2026 Guide)

Choosing the right robe colour for your bridal party is one of those small details that makes your getting-ready photos look effortlessly coordinated. Here's our guide to the most popular shades and the wedding themes they suit best.

Dusty Rose & Blush

The perennial favourite for romantic, garden, and vintage weddings. Blush robes photograph beautifully in natural light and complement almost every skin tone.

Sage Green

A top pick for rustic barn, botanical, and outdoor weddings. Sage pairs perfectly with neutral florals and earthy tones.

Ivory & Champagne

Ideal if you want a cohesive, tonal look where the bride and bridesmaids feel unified. Champagne robes feel luxurious and timeless.

Lilac & Soft Lavender

A fresh choice for spring and early summer weddings. Lavender works especially well in bright, airy venues.

Navy & Midnight Blue

For winter, black-tie, or classic church weddings. Deep tones add drama and look stunning in candlelit photography.

Mixing Tones

Many brides choose a slightly different shade for the maid of honour — for example, dusty rose for bridesmaids and a deeper mauve for the MOH. This creates a beautiful gradient effect in photos.
